This exciting opportunity will assist the Head of Trusts to maximise income to support the Association’s care and research programmes. As a Trusts Fundraising Officer, you will manage a portfolio of trusts and foundations, to maintain and increase trust income.

Key priorities for this role include:

- Research trust priorities and guidelines and match projects to funders; identify new funding opportunities and develop high quality funding proposals
- Monitor the delivery and spend of funded projects
- Manage funder relationships and provide excellent stewardship

This collaborative role will involve developing good relationships with our Research, Care, External Affairs and Finance Teams to develop project proposals and budgets for new and existing services.

This is a hybrid-working opportunity with the expectation to work from the Northampton office approx. 1 - 2 days per month.

**What are we looking for?**

Experience of trust fundraising with a proven track record of securing income against set targets is essential.

You will need to have experience of developing and writing high quality trust proposals and the ability to work collaboratively with operational teams.

Excellent communication skills are key, you will need to build good relationships with external funding bodies, trusts and internal audiences.

Key skills include: Excellent attention to detail, ability to develop accurate budgets, work to tight deadline and maintain an excellent level of supporter care.

The MND Association was founded in 1979. Our mission is to improve care and support for people with MND, their families and carers. We also fund and promote research that leads to new understanding and treatments and brings us closer to a cure for MND. The Association also campaigns and raises awareness so the needs of people with MND, and everyone who cares for them, are recognised, and addressed by wider society.
